Auction InformationAuction InformationAuction Information

Everything will be sold ―as is.‖ South County Habitat for Humanity makes no warranties or representations with respect to any items or services sold.

Buyers must take their items with them unless other arrangements are made.

Be sure to examine item restrictions before purchasing. Please check expira-tion dates on gift certificates, blackout dates, and other limitations on items.

Silent Auction Bidding ProceduresSilent Auction Bidding ProceduresSilent Auction Bidding Procedures

Bidding on Silent auction items will open at 6:00 p.m.

To raise a bid, write your bidder number and the amount of your bid on the Silent Auction Item Sheet posted near the item. Note the bid increments listed on the sheet. The opening bid and minimum bidding increment will be on the Item Sheet.

Live Auction Bidding ProceduresLive Auction Bidding ProceduresLive Auction Bidding Procedures

To bid on an item, the bidder raises his or her hand with the numbered card, di-recting the signal toward the auctioneer and the clerk.

If the auctioneer determines that any bid is not commensurate with the value of the article or service offered, he may reject the same and withdraw the item from sale.

The highest bidder acknowledged by the auctioneer shall be the purchaser. In the event of any dispute between the bidders, the auctioneer shall have sole and final discretion either to determine the successful bidder, or to re-offer and resell the article in dispute.

Checkout ProceduresCheckout ProceduresCheckout Procedures

We will do our best to make the process go smoothly but checkout will still take a little time...please be patient! Following these steps will help:

After the close of the auction, bidders should proceed to the cashier’s tables, lo-cated at the main entrance/exit. Please do not attempt to check out before the close of the Live Auction.

When paying, please present your bidder number to the clerk. The cashier will total the values of the items you have won. Buyers must pay full purchase price by cash, check, Visa, American Express, MasterCard, or Discover. Checks should be made payable to South County Habitat for Humanity.

Habitat volunteers will assist you in gathering your items. Please ask if you have any questions. Please do not attempt to collect your items without assis-tance.

Habitat for Humanity InternationalHabitat for Humanity InternationalHabitat for Humanity International

Founded by Millard and Linda Fuller in 1976, Habitat for Humanity International (HFHI) is an ecumenical, Christian, non-profit affordable housing provider. Habitat’s mission is to eliminate poverty housing and homelessness by building ―simple, decent, affordable‖ homes in partnership with people in need. The larg-est non-profit home builder in the United States, HFHI has constructed over 500,000 homes throughout the world, housing more than 2 million people.

Habitat for Humanity in South CountyHabitat for Humanity in South CountyHabitat for Humanity in South County

South County Habitat for Humanity is a 501(c)(3) non-profit Christian organiza-tion and relies on financial and volunteer support from businesses, churches, foundations, and individuals to operate. Unless otherwise specified, all donations received are dedicated to building materials and construction related expenses.

Our goal is to help people who live in substandard housing or who cannot find affordable shelter achieve the dream of homeownership. We accomplish this by building new homes or renovating existing dwellings by making them energy effi-cient and affordable to own. Homeowners are selected on a basis that they have need for housing, demonstrate the ability to make timely mortgage payments while also falling within HUD income limits, and agree to contribute ―sweat eq-uity‖ hours towards construction of their home. All Habitat homes are sold with-out profit and mortgages are issued on a no-interest basis.

South County Habitat for HumanitySouth County Habitat for HumanitySouth County Habitat for Humanity ―Building houses, building hope‖ for 21years!―Building houses, building hope‖ for 21years!―Building houses, building hope‖ for 21years!

Founded in 1990

44 homes built in Washington County, RI in partnership with

44 families

33 newly constructed homes

11 rehabilitated homes

5 duplex homes and 1 triplex home

60 Adult Homeowners

105 Children welcomed home

71 homes built in developing countries such as Kyrgyzstan, Bot-

swana & Honduras through SCH's Tithe donations to HFHI

216 Active SCHFH Volunteers in 2010-2011

13,500 Volunteer Hours worked in 2010-2011
